B & A Ltd Quarterly Results Key Highlights
- The revenue of B & A Ltd for the Dec '25 is ₹ 81.41 crore as compare to the Sep '25 revenue of ₹ 103.95 crore.
- This represent the decline of -21.68% The ebitda of B & A Ltd for the Dec '25 is ₹ -2.49 crore as compare to the Sep '25 ebitda of ₹ 31.11 crore.
- This represent the decline of -108% The net profit of B & A Ltd for the Dec '25 is ₹ -5.52 crore as compare to the Sep '25 net profit of ₹ 26.38 crore.
- This represent the decline of -120%.

Historical Revenue of B & A Ltd
Revenue term means the amount of money a company earns from its primary business activities such as the sales of its products & services. Types of Revenue: 1. Operating revenue: It refers to the income generated from the core business activities, which are sales of goods or services rendered. 2. Non-Operating revenue: It is the income generated from secondary sources unrelated to the primary business. Examples include rents, dividends, interest, and royalty fees. Formula for Revenue: The formula for calculating revenue is based on two goods & services: For goods: Revenue = Avg unit price x Number of Units sold For services: Revenue = Avg unit price x Number of Customers served.
